POLAND – PRACTICAL INFORMATION
Offical name: Rzeczpospolita Polska (The Republic of Poland).
Motto: The phrase Bóg, Honor, Ojczyzna ("God, Honor, Fatherland") is unoffical but often used.
Location: Poland is located in Central Europe, east of Germany.
Geographic coordinates: 52 00 N , 20 00 E
Climate: Moderate, similar to that of Germany. Cold, cloudy, moderately severe winters with frequent snow precipitation; mild, sometimes hot summers with frequent showers and thunderstorms. In September the weather is generally fine and sunny, and temperatures vary from 100C to 260C but rain and/or storms are also possible.
Terrain: Mostly flat plain, mountains along the southern border.
Member of: NATO, European Community.
Visas for visitors: For citizens of the European Community countries, Andora, Antigua and Barbuda, Argentina, Australia, Bahama, Barbados, Brazil, Brunei, Canada, Chile, Costa Rica, Croatia, Guatemala, Honduras, Hong Kong, Island, Izrael, Japan, South Korea, Liechtenstein, Macau, Malyasia, Mauritius, Mexico, Monaco, Nikaragua, New Zealand, Panama, Paraguay, Saint Kitts and Nevis, Salvador, San Marino, Seyschele, Singapore, Switzerland, Uruguay, U.S.A., Venezuela and Vaticane visas are not required. Citizens of all other countries must obtain visas in Polish embassies or consulates. Poland joined the Schengen agreement several years ago, and free transfer from neighbouring European Community countries is possible.
Ethnic groups: Polish 96.7 %, national minorities (German, Ruthenian, Belarusian, Lithuanian and others) - 3.3 %.
Languages: Polish is the oficial and commonly used language. All people use the standard language; dialects may be encountered in Highlands and in some rural regions. English and German are the most common second languages spoken in Poland, though some middle-aged people may also be contacted in Russian.
Alphabet: Latin, extra letters: ą, ę, ł, ć, ń, ó, ś, ź, ż.
Religions: Roman Catholic – about 95%, Protestant, Greek Catholic, Orthodox, and Armenian minorities 5%
Time zone: Poland is located in the same time zone as France and Germany, i.e. winter: UTC+1, summer: UTC+2.
Units system: Metric. The application of the SI system is mandatory.
Currency: 1 zloty (plural: zlotys) = 100 groszy (singular: grosz). Banknotes come in of 10, 20, 50, 100, and 200 PLN denominations. Coins come in 1, 2, 5, 10, 20, 50 groszy, and 1, 2, 5 zlotys. Exchange rate 1 Euro = 4.15 zloty (variable exchange rate). Currencies may be exchanged at a bank or a currency exchange office.
Electric current: Alternate current, 230 V, 50 Hz. Sockets are identical with those in Germany.
Telephone system: Developed fixed-line system completed with mobile-cellular service. Cellular coverage is generally good with rare gaps in the eastern zone of the country. International code: 48. Internal direct dialing with automatic extensions.
Internet country code: .pl
Main airports: Warszawa/Warsaw (Warszawa-Okęcie), F. Chopin (codes: WAW, EPWA). Kraków/Cracow (Kraków-Balice), Jan Paweł II (codes: KRK, EPKR).
Car drives: On the right.
Car driving regulations: Generally do not differ from regulations encountered in European Community countries.
Maximum driving speed: Cities and villages: 50 km/h. Motorways outside cities and villages: 90 km/h. Motorways: 130 km/h.
Acceptable alcohol concentration for car driving persons: 0 %.
